What type of playing surface are these boots best suited for?

These boots (TF - Turf) are specifically designed for artificial grass or turf pitches. They provide optimal grip and performance on these surfaces.

Can these boots be used on a natural grass pitch?

No, these boots are not recommended for natural grass pitches. The outsole is designed for turf and may not provide adequate grip or could cause discomfort and potential injury on harder or softer ground.

Setup, Compatibility & Care

Setup: These boots come ready to wear out of the box. Ensure the correct size is selected for optimal fit and performance.

Compatibility: The 'TF' designation signifies 'Turf'. These boots are specifically designed for use on artificial grass or turf pitches. They are *not* recommended for use on firm ground (FG), soft ground (SG), or natural grass surfaces, as the outsole pattern is optimized for artificial turf traction and may not perform as expected or could lead to injury on other surfaces.

Care:

  1. Cleaning: After each use, remove excess dirt and mud with a soft brush or dry cloth. For tougher stains, use a slightly damp cloth. Avoid using harsh detergents or abrasive cleaners.
  2. Drying: Allow the boots to air dry naturally at room temperature. Do not place them near direct heat sources like radiators or in a tumble dryer, as this can damage the materials.
  3. Storage: Store the boots in a cool, dry place, preferably in a boot bag, away from direct sunlight.
